Output dd3af31a7a2347139d75ca5298c6aeec7efe7aab7672368c912fa2009d425833:19

value
364146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0c4aa10f37cad7b4ba251fd447cbd010a8bf1e OP_EQUAL
address
37FosGv1jPVhYhceMMZMYwLsgpEcmrVqcp
transaction
dd3af31a7a2347139d75ca5298c6aeec7efe7aab7672368c912fa2009d425833
spent
true